Flights cancelled at Gatwick after short-notice staff absences
Temporary Air traffic control restrictions in place causing delays and diversionsFlights have been cancelled, delayed and rerouted at Gatwick due to short-notice staff absences in the air traffic control team, the airport has said.The hub in West Sussex has apologised to those affected by the temporary air traffic control restrictions enforced on Thursday evening. HS2 at risk of further cuts to route north of Birmingham amid budget squeeze
Fresh uncertainty for high-speed line as leak suggests Sunak and Hunt have discussed cost implications of Manchester phaseThe HS2 high-speed rail line is at risk of further cuts to its route north of Birmingham as the government considers whether it can afford high-cost projects in advance of the autumn budget.The project has been mired in fresh uncertainty after the prime minister’s spokesperson refused to guarantee on Thursday it would run to Manchester, after publication of a photograph -

Fully electric cargo route now available between England and Scotland
Rail Technology Magazine - A fully electric rail cargo route between Birmingham and Glasgow has been launched. The partnership between Carousel Logistics and Varamis Rail, the UK's first electric-only express rail freight operator, will see former passenger trains converted to carry cargo at speeds of up to 100 miles per hour. -
